Date: 17th century
Description: 108 Srivaishnava divyadeshams. Sarangapani of Tirukkodandai (Kumbakonam) reclining on the serpent Shesha in his chariot-shaped shrine drawn by a horse. From the navel of Sarangapani issues a lotus on which is seated Brahma. On the bottom left, the temple tank.
Location: Tamil NaduTemple;Kallapiran Temple;Srivaikuntham
Positioning: Inner prakara, south wall, top row

Date: 17th century
Description: 108 Srivaishnava divyadeshams. Govindaraja of Tiruchitrakutam (Chidambaram) reclining on the serpent Shesha. A lotus, on which Brahma is seated, emerges from Govindaraja’s navel. One of his consorts sits near his head, the other at his feet. In the foreground: two devotees.
Location: Tamil Nadu Temple;Kallapiran Temple;Srivaikuntham
Positioning: Inner prakara, west wall, top row
